  • Patent number: 7097327
    Abstract: A lever pivot safety stop socket for fluorescent lamps. The device consists of a molded plastic housing which includes electrical contact strips, attached to power leads; and a plastic, levered and slotted rotor. The rotor fits into an opening in the housing face, leaving its lever portion outside, and able to turn the rotor. Both housing top and lever portion include a wide slot, and when the lever is pointing towards the housing top, the slots line up. This is the lamp installation position, allowing lamp terminal end pins to be easily dropped into the housing slot and into the rotor slots. The lamp can then be rotated a quarter turn in either direction by the lever, to make a full connection with the power contacts in the housing. Provision is made so that no more than a quarter turn can be made from the installation position in either direction, avoiding “opens”, arcing and possible damage. A mounting bracket is attached to the housing for mounting the socket.

  • Patent number: 7011195
    Abstract: An improved suitcase base and an improved pulling handle for use in a soft-sided suitcase and a hard-sided suitcase, giving the luggage, easy pulling characteristics. The base is nearly symmetrical in shape, with a V-shaped bottom wall forming an obtuse angle, which creates good ground clearance for the suitcase bottom under all conditions of towing over flat or uneven surfaces. Provision is made for securely latching the pulling handle while stored, and for quick, easy release from storage for pulling handle deployment. A duffle bag luggage carrier that incorporates the improved base, is also described. The improved base and quick-release pulling handle are easily adaptable to different styled soft-sided and hard-sided suitcases, and for non-suitcase luggage carriers.

  • Patent number: 7000658
    Abstract: A precision adjustable woodworking platform that is self-calibrating and designed to move a tool very accurately back and forth horizontally and up and down. One of a number of different woodworking tools is fastened in a saddle that can be rotated and set at a selected angle for operations such as mitering. A floating work table is provided for holding a workpiece at any angle to a cutting tool movement direction. At the same time, the floating work table can be moved precisely forward and backward. The invention woodworking platform is relatively inexpensive, while providing for accurate straight, angled and depth cuts; all without needing external instruments.

  • Patent number: 6929589
    Abstract: An improved device for athletic exercise by pulling at a resisting force. The device consists of a number of spring housing assemblies that are stacked and clamped in a column with at least one pulley wheel assembly to which a cord and pull handle is attached. A grooved metal shaft is disposed throughout the column longitudinal axis to drive all the constant-force spring assemblies which are stacked inside the device when the pulley wheel is caused to rotate. A person uses the device by first selecting which spring assemblies he wants to produce a particular resisting force level, by pushing separate selector levers, one for each spring. He then pulls at the pull handle to experience the chosen resisting force. The device design allows a user the choice of many resisting force levels, using only a small number of spring assemblies. The device is small, light in weight and conveniently shaped for easy attachment to any suitable restraining object.

  • Patent number: 6793081
    Abstract: A locking neck ring device that is placed over a capped bottle or container and grips the bottle neck ring, and together with a padlock or other securing means, prevents access to the bottle cap. The locking device comprises a clamp member that jackets a capped bottle neck; a cover which fits over the clamp member causing it to clamp on to the neck below the neck ring, and means to hold the clamp member to the cover. Provision is made for attaching a padlock or other securing means which holds the locking ring device in place. The bottle or container cap can then not be accessed for removal. The device is applicable to all sizes of drug containers, wine and liquor bottles for effectively locking access to the container contents.

  • Patent number: 6780310
    Abstract: A variable vortex, baffle fluid filter apparatus for installation primarily in urban storm water drain sumps. A circular, filter channel that is enclosed on all four sides by filter screens, includes a cylindrical baffle screen that is attached concentrically below the channel for moving impurities to the sump bottom. Provision is made for manually adjusting the velocity of the fluid inlet flow. An angle adjustable, pivotable vane is provided in front of the inlet opening to adjust inlet flow velocity and vortex strength, to keep inlet impurities from sticking to the filter screens. The filter unit provides 150 percent more treatment capacity than comparable filter units and provides easy access for maintenance to all parts.

  • Patent number: 6668608
    Abstract: A dual-sided key ring holder that allows a key ring to be released from one end. The device uses a real or equivalent shell casing, and a real or equivalent shaped bullet member that fits in the mouth of the shell casing. The bullet member includes a hole in the nose for fastening a key ring thereto. A spring-loaded piston which is disposed inside the shell casing, normally acts on the bullet member to retain the bullet member in the casing. The piston includes a rigid tab which projects from the head of the shell casing and may be manually pulled to release the bullet member with a key ring from the casing. Provision is also made for fastening a key ring to the tab.

  • Patent number: 6588809
    Abstract: A latching device which comprises a cabinet door catch member and a cabinet probe member that is adapted to engage the catch member. The probe member includes a floating shaft that is disposed axially in a housing, and which includes a projection that is shaped and positioned to engage a groove in the catch member when the door is closed. Provision is made for automatic separation and opening of the cabinet door when the catch member is released by the probe member shaft. Release of the catch member is effected by a single smart rap on the outside of the door. The device is simple, reliable and economical to produce.

  • Patent number: 6529142
    Abstract: A system for locating a vehicle that is parked in a parking lot, a parking garage or on a street. The system comprises two separate signal generator/processor circuits, each circuit being contained in a module, one being a hand-held locator module and the other, a receive/response module that is installed in a vehicle. Both modules, when activated by user, communicate with the other by means of specially encoded radio signals. To find a parked vehicle, a user merely presses a pushbutton on the locator module which transmits a high frequency search signal. In response, the receive/response module emits a direction indicating signal to the locator module, which then displays the direction and elevation of the vehicle with respect to the user location. Provision is made for the receive/response module to operate without a connection to a vehicle battery if necessary, allowing the module to be used portably. The system is small in size, inexpensive and easy to use.

  • Patent number: 6477870
    Abstract: A cable end locking device that is used for securing the swaged end of a cable that is attached to a portable equipment. The device is simple, having only three parts: a tubular shell with an axial hole in one end for inserting a cable end, a tubular piston with an axial bore that is located inside the shell, and a key-operated cylinder lock that locks the piston in place. The piston bore hole and shell end hole are offset, which reduces the cable aperture, so that when locked, an inserted cable end can not be pulled out of the shell hole. An alternative embodiment of the device does not use a cylinder lock as the locking means. Instead, means are provided for a wire rope, cable, shaft or padlock to be used to lock the piston in place. The device can also be used to secure the end of a shaft.

  • Patent number: 6446988
    Abstract: An easily pulled, rolling cooler for storing refrigerables which can be manually towed by pulling a handle that is designed to resist torsion. The cooler has two wheels that are located directly under the cooler center of gravity to minimize pulling strain for the user. Provision is made for the handle to be folded down and stored on the cooler lid when not being used for towing. The cooler bottom is V-shaped, providing good ground clearance for the back end of the cooler when being towed over uneven ground. The cooler is light weight, compact and easily fitted in a car trunk or in a van for travel to picnics.
